Output eff3e097868c97dfc9c8d1bd910b5dd181a8e4048fbaa28de6a9f6b6c289bbb7:3

value
534822605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1048fd21ef5a1366f02fd1139babb45837dbbd00 OP_EQUAL
address
33B8AxrAD27XqNfGtYUbX1heJAqSi6xzqH
transaction
eff3e097868c97dfc9c8d1bd910b5dd181a8e4048fbaa28de6a9f6b6c289bbb7
spent
true